public final class ModelElementFactory {
static {
ModelElementFactoryAccessor.setDefault(new ModelElementFactoryAccessor() {
@Override
public ModelElementFactory createModelElementFactory() {
return new ModelElementFactory();
}
});
}
private ModelElementFactory() {
super();
}
public JsFunction newGlobalObject(FileObject fileObject, int length) {
return JsFunctionImpl.createGlobal(fileObject, length, null);
}
public JsObject loadGlobalObject(FileObject fileObject, int length,
String sourceLabel, URL defaultDocURL) throws IOException {
InputStream is = fileObject.getInputStream();
try {
return loadGlobalObject(is, sourceLabel, defaultDocURL);
} finally {
is.close();
}
}
public JsObject loadGlobalObject(InputStream is, String sourceLabel, URL defaultDocURL) throws IOException {
JsFunction global = newGlobalObject(null, Integer.MAX_VALUE);
BufferedReader reader = new BufferedReader(new InputStreamReader(is, "UTF-8")); // NOI18N
try {
for (JsObject object : Model.readModel(reader, global, sourceLabel, defaultDocURL)) {
putGlobalProperty(global, object);
}
return global;
} finally {
reader.close();
}
}
public JsObject putGlobalProperty(JsFunction global, JsObject property) {
if (property.getParent() != global) {
throw new IllegalArgumentException("Property is not child of global");
}
JsObject wrapped;
if (property instanceof JsFunction) {
GlobalFunction real = new GlobalFunction((JsFunction) property);
real.setParentScope(global);
real.setParent(global);
wrapped = real;
} else {
GlobalObject real = new GlobalObject(property);
real.setParent(global);
wrapped = real;
}
global.addProperty(wrapped.getName(), wrapped);
return wrapped;
}
public JsObject newObject(JsObject parent, String name, OffsetRange offsetRange, boolean isDeclared) {
return newObject(parent, name, offsetRange, isDeclared, null);
}
public JsObject newObject(JsObject parent, String name, OffsetRange offsetRange, boolean isDeclared, String sourceLabel) {
return new JsObjectImpl(parent, new Identifier(name, offsetRange), offsetRange, isDeclared, null, sourceLabel);
}
public JsFunction newFunction(DeclarationScope scope, JsObject parent, String name, Collection<String> params) {
return newFunction(scope, parent, name, params, null);
}
public JsFunction newFunction(DeclarationScope scope, JsObject parent, String name, Collection<String> params, String sourceLabel) {
List<Identifier> realParams = new ArrayList<Identifier>();
for (String param : params) {
realParams.add(new Identifier(param, OffsetRange.NONE));
}
return newFunction(scope, parent, new Identifier(name, OffsetRange.NONE), realParams, OffsetRange.NONE, sourceLabel);
}
public JsFunction newFunction(DeclarationScope scope, JsObject parent, String name, Collection<String> params, OffsetRange range, String sourceLabel) {
List<Identifier> realParams = new ArrayList<Identifier>();
for (String param : params) {
realParams.add(new Identifier(param, OffsetRange.NONE));
}
return newFunction(scope, parent, new Identifier(name, OffsetRange.NONE), realParams, range, sourceLabel);
}
public JsFunction newFunction(DeclarationScope scope, JsObject parent, Identifier name, List<Identifier> params, OffsetRange range) {
return newFunction(scope, parent, name, params, range, null);
}
public JsFunction newFunction(DeclarationScope scope, JsObject parent, Identifier name, List<Identifier> params, OffsetRange range, String sourceLabel) {
return new JsFunctionImpl(scope, parent, name, params, range, null, sourceLabel);
}
public JsObject newReference(JsObject parent, String name, OffsetRange offsetRange,
JsObject original, boolean isDeclared, @NullAllowed Set<Modifier> modifiers) {
if (original instanceof JsFunction) {
return new JsFunctionReference(parent, new Identifier(name, offsetRange),
(JsFunction) original, isDeclared, modifiers);
} else if (original instanceof JsArray) {
return new JsArrayReference(parent, new Identifier(name, offsetRange),
(JsArray) original, isDeclared, modifiers);
}
return new JsObjectReference(parent, new Identifier(name, offsetRange),
original, isDeclared, modifiers);
}
public JsObject newReference(String name, JsObject original, boolean isDeclared) {
if (original instanceof JsFunction) {
return new OriginalParentFunctionReference(new Identifier(name, OffsetRange.NONE), (JsFunction) original, isDeclared);
} else if (original instanceof JsArray) {
return new OriginalParentArrayReference(new Identifier(name, OffsetRange.NONE), (JsArray) original, isDeclared);
}
return new OriginalParentObjectReference(new Identifier(name, OffsetRange.NONE), original, isDeclared);
}
public JsObject newReference(String name, JsObject original, boolean isDeclared, boolean isVirtual) {
JsObject object = newReference(name, original, isDeclared);
((JsObjectImpl)object).setVirtual(isVirtual);
return object;
}
public TypeUsage newType(String name, int offset, boolean resolved) {
return new TypeUsage(name, offset, resolved);
}
